PERFORMANCE PROJECTS

We create large scale, site responsive promenade performances based around an open access choir and our original choral compositions. Anyone can join our choir to take part in these special events.

From the begining

Sound dots.png

Each project begins with an idea, a theme or a location as inspiration for our creative journey, and we create our choir afresh each time.

Many of our singers take part on a regular basis and each project includes people joining us for the first time

Rehearsals

A project usually lasts around 3 months from first rehearsal to performance.

We begin with regular rehearsals to learn the songs, which we teach by ear.

All the music is original, written specifically for the Voice Project Choir, and designed to be inspiring and uplifting, ambitious and rewarding to perform.

Performance

Our productions are theatrical and use the performance spaces in a whole variety of ways with the choir animating different locations alongside the Voice Project Quintet and other musicians.

 

On performance day we have final rehearsals and then invite the audience to the performances.
